Rutgers University-New Brunswick Cost by Family Income

What you actually pay after grants and scholarships, broken down by household income. Numbers below reflect the average net price reported to the U.S. Department of Education.

Family Income $0 – $30,000 $15,885/yr
Family Income $30,001 – $48,000 $15,532/yr
Family Income $48,001 – $75,000 $17,578/yr
Family Income $75,001 – $110,000 $24,020/yr
💡

Low-income families (earning under $30k) pay an average of $15,885/year — often covered almost entirely by Pell Grants and institutional aid.

Frequently Asked Questions about Rutgers University-New Brunswick

What is the acceptance rate at Rutgers University-New Brunswick?

Rutgers University-New Brunswick has an acceptance rate of 65.4%, making it an accessible institution with moderate admissions standards.

How much is tuition at Rutgers University-New Brunswick?

Tuition at Rutgers University-New Brunswick is $17,239 per year. Net price and financial aid options may reduce this cost significantly depending on individual circumstances.

What is the average salary for graduates of Rutgers University-New Brunswick?

Graduates of Rutgers University-New Brunswick earn a median salary of $74,479 per year, based on 2026 U.S. Department of Education earnings data.
